Board of Health Accepts Doerflinger Resignation; Names Brian Downs as Acting Commissioner

Tuesday, February 13, 2018
For Immediate Release – Contact Tony Sellars, 405-271-5601
The Oklahoma State Board of Health voted to accept the resignation of Oklahoma State Department of Health (OSDH) Interim Commission Preston Doerflinger during their regular monthly meeting on Tuesday. The resignation is effective immediately.
Brian Downs, OSDH Director of State and Federal Policy, was named acting commissioner by the board.
Following the vote, board president Martha Burger stated that an immediate search for an interim commissioner would begin. “Hopefully we will have candidates ready to vet in 30 to 60 days and have an interim commissioner in place shortly after that time.”
Downs emphasized that OSDH has a strong leadership team in place that is committed to the agency reorganization currently underway.
“We have a dedicated leadership team that is committed to get OSDH back on sound financial footing,” said Downs. “Our entire organization remains focused on protecting the health of all Oklahomans and restoring confidence in this agency.”
